Transaction ec5b3d396e4f653c71dff4fcbf71df430a1dcbfc2e22de6f2cc03c8f5329e128

block
9aa81fb601c49fb3c72f9a574ed20c1e0a195c3652c4dad07d2f747b67b8015c

1 Input

36 Outputs